The Huatai (aka Hawtai) B35 SUV debuted as a concept at the 2010 Beijing Auto Show. It came back as a production car to the 2011 Shanghai Auto Show with a new nose and a new name: Baolige. The English name is yet unknown. The Baolige will be listed on the Chinese market in July.

The Baolige is based on the last gen Hyundai Sante-Fe platform. Engine is the 1.8 turbo from SAIC with 118kw and 215nm There will also be a 2.0 turbo diesel with 110kw and 310nm. Size: 4618x1858x1753. Price will start around 135.000 yuan.
